Secret Features of Gable Roofs



Including a distinctive triangular form, gable roofs are recognized for their traditional and classic charm. These roofings have 2 sloping sides that satisfy at a ridge, developing a gable at each end. The straightforward style of saddleback roofs makes them prominent among home owners searching for a typical look that additionally uses effective water drainage and sufficient attic room.

One vital attribute of saddleback roofs is their exceptional ventilation capabilities. Furthermore, gable roofs are reasonably easy to build and maintain contrasted to much more complex roof layouts. The straightforward construction of saddleback roofs makes them an economical option for numerous house owners. Nevertheless, it's necessary to ensure correct bracing and assistance in locations prone to solid winds or hefty snow tons to stop architectural concerns.

Benefits of Hip Roof Coverings



With their particular all sides sloping down to the walls, hip roof coverings supply numerous advantages for property owners.

One key advantage of hip roof coverings is their outstanding stability and sturdiness in high-wind and snowy locations. The sloping style minimizes the risk of wind damages by providing less surface for solid winds to press against, making them a reliable selection for areas prone to tornados.

Additionally, the angle of a hip roofing system allows for reliable water drainage, stopping water pooling and prospective leakages, which can help extend the lifespan of the roof covering and protect the framework of your home.

Hip roofing systems also use extra attic room space and possibility for ventilation compared to gable roofs, offering better insulation and power performance for your home.

Features of Apartment and Mansard Roofs



What differentiates flat and mansard roof coverings from various other types? Flat roofings are specifically as they sound - level and straight. They're preferred for contemporary and minimal layouts, providing a sleek and modern look. Level roofings are easier to build and keep, making them economical options. Nonetheless, they require appropriate drainage systems to prevent water merging, which can lead to leakages.

On the other hand, mansard roofs have a steeper reduced slope and a shallower top slope, frequently including dormer home windows. This design permits extra space or storage space in the attic room. Mansard roof coverings are aesthetically striking and include a touch of sophistication to a structure. They're frequently seen in French design and supply good resistance to strong winds as a result of their dual incline structure.

Both flat and mansard roofing systems use one-of-a-kind appearances and useful benefits, accommodating various architectural designs and preferences.
